Top 10 Early Education Podcasts for Providers

Written by Winnie | Jul 31, 2024 6:21:13 PM

Staying updated with the latest trends and methods in early childhood education can be challenging. Podcasts have emerged as a convenient way for childcare providers to enhance their knowledge, gain new insights, and implement innovative teaching strategies.

Whether you're driving, exercising, or winding down after a busy day, tuning into a podcast can be an excellent way to keep learning. Here are some of the best early education podcasts that every childcare provider should consider adding to their playlist.

1. Real Talk for Real Teachers

Host: Dr. Becky Bailey

A bi-monthly podcast from Conscious Discipline creator Dr. Becky Bailey, the podcast explores trends in social-emotional learning and classroom management.

Why Listen: Focuses on practical strategies for social-emotional learning and effective classroom management.

2. How Preschool Teachers Do It

Hosts: Cindy Terebush and Alison Kentos

How Preschool Teachers Do It is a podcast for everyone who works with or raises early learners. Hosts Cindy and Alison discuss practical strategies and share stories from their experiences in early childhood education.

Why Listen: Offers relatable and actionable advice for preschool teachers and caregivers.

3. The Preschool Podcast

Host: Various experts

If you work in childcare, preschool, or early years settings, The Preschool Podcast provides inspiring and motivational stories, as well as practical advice for managing your organization, center, or classroom.

Why Listen: Offers diverse perspectives and practical tips for early childhood educators.

4. Child Care Bar & Grill

Hosts: Lisa Murphy and Jeff A. Johnson

A humorous, informative, and slightly irreverent podcast for childcare providers and other early learning professionals, Child Care Bar & Grill is hosted by authors, speakers, and play advocates Lisa Murphy and Jeff A. Johnson.

Why Listen: Combines humor with practical advice, making it an engaging and insightful listen for everyday inspiration.

5. Elevating Early Childhood

Host: Various experts

On Elevating Early Childhood, the podcast aims to level the playing field and bridge the gap between preschool, pre-k, and K-12 education. It provides insights into teaching better, saving time, and living more.

Why Listen: Offers innovative ideas to improve early childhood education practices and streamline classroom management.

6. The Everything ECE Podcast

Host: Early Learning Foundations

Brought to you by Early Learning Foundations, The Everything ECE Podcast is perfect for early childhood educators and leaders working in childcare, preschool, or kindergarten settings. This podcast offers inspiration and actionable steps with professional and personal tips and tricks to help you find that ideal work-life balance.

Why Listen: Provides a blend of professional development and personal growth strategies tailored for early childhood educators.

7. Preschool and Beyond

Host: Various experts

Preschool and Beyond answers common questions that arise during the preschool years and provides helpful tips and ideas on how to engage with your preschool children. The podcast features teachers, researchers, and other early childhood experts.

Why Listen: Provides practical advice and insights from various early childhood experts.

8. Pre-K Teach & Play Podcast

Host: Various experts

A place where ECE {r}evolutionaries reclaim children’s right to learn through play, reimagine inclusive classrooms, and {r}evolutionize early care and education.

Why Listen: Focuses on play-based learning and inclusive education strategies.

9. Early Childhood Business Made Easy

Host: Kelley Peake

Tune in each week to the Happiness Hustle – Early Childhood Business Made Easy Podcast with Kelley Peake, an ex-corporate childcare leader turned CEO of multiple million-dollar early childhood businesses. Kelley aims to help early childhood business leaders, managers, and owners control the chaos, ditch the exhausting overwhelm, and maintain joy while building profitable businesses that make a difference.

Why Listen: Offers practical advice on managing and growing early childhood education businesses effectively.

10. The Early Childhood Nerd

Host: Heather Bernt-Santy

Each week, host Heather Bernt-Santy and a member of the ECE Nerd Collective share and discuss a quote, focusing on effecting change in the early learning world.

Why Listen: Encourages critical thinking and reflection on early childhood education practices.

11. Child Care Rockstar™ Radio Podcast

Host: Kris Murray

Tune in to top childcare business expert Kris Murray on the Child Care Rockstar™ Radio podcast for interviews with early childhood leaders and experts that will leave you inspired to achieve the next level of success.

Why Listen: Provides inspiration and business strategies for childcare providers aiming to elevate their practice.
